In most cases, this is a result of the library not subscribing to all titles in every online collection. The Library generally subscribes to a number of titles in each collection; however costs prevent a subscription to all available titles in all collections.

Titles to which we subscribe are generally listed, along with links to the online journal at the bottom of the e-Resources page where you can browse via the A-Z list. Alternatively, you can often check if the title is meant to be available via Western Sydney University within the collection site. Depending on the site/collection, this information is found under headings similar to 'subscriptions', 'browse' or 'profile'.
